This is on eCS 2.0 RC1. Perhaps it is the sorting of >> Config.sys during the install, but all this works fine with 5.06. Can >> you post all the sequence of config.sys lines that effect RSJ? Al >> just posted most but not the DANIATAPI.FLT line. Here I have: >> >> DEVICE=H:\PROGRAMS\RSJCD\RSJSCSI.SYS /S >> IFS=H:\PROGRAMS\RSJCD\CDWFS.IFS >> >> >> BASEDEV=OS2ASPI.DMD /ALL >> DEVICE=H:\OS2\BOOT\ASPINKK.SYS /v <- This is a replacement for >> ASPIROUT that is included with DVDDAO >> BASEDEV=DaniATAPI.FLT /RSJ >> BASEDEV=LOCKCDR.FLT -v >> >> >> RUN=H:\PROGRAMS\RSJCD\CDWFSD.EXE -p "F:/temp" -c200000 -b20480 -t2 >> -i3 -s0 >> >Here's what works for me: >REM DEVICE=C:\OS2\BOOT\OS2CDROM.DMD >DEVICE=C:\OS2\BOOT\JJSCDROM.DMD /V /FC+ /FX+ /FM+ /R:1 /W >[...] >BASEDEV=DANIS506.ADD /V /GBM /A:0 /U:0 /IT:5 /A:1 /BAY /A:2 /BAY /A:3 >/PCS [...] >BASEDEV=DANIATAP.FLT /EJ /A:1 /U:0 /TYPE:ZWL /RSJ >[...] >BASEDEV=OS2ASPI.DMD /ALL >[...] >REM *** RSJ CD-Writer File System *** >BASEDEV=LOCKCDR.FLT >REM BASEDEV=RSJIDECD.FLT >DEVICE=J:\CDWFS\RSJSCSI.SYS >IFS=J:\CDWFS\CDWFS.IFS >RUN=J:\CDWFS\CDWFSD.EXE -p "C:/VAR/TEMP" -c80000 -b16384 -t2 -i3 -s0 REM >*** RSJ CD-Writer File System *** >N.B.: Dani outlines four different scenarios for setting up DaniATAPI >for RSJ. Mine is but one of them. I also use my ThinkPad docked, which >is why I have two /BAY statements on the Dani1S506 line. >We're really going OT on this thread.
